Have just installed mailwasher on Mum's computer (W95) but when I launch Mailwasher I get:

Error starting program
The MAILWASHER.EXE file is linked to missing export WININET.DLL:InternetGetConnectedState.

114716 2003-01-17 10:31:00 What version of Internet Explorer? I think you will find the problem may go away if IE is version 5 or greater.

If thats not the case, then the WININET.DLL is probably too old or incompatable, there are plenty of places to download from, try Google

Your Windows 95 system lacks the required Internet {options}. You need to upgrade Internet Explorer to 5.5 SP2. You may get away with a slightly earlier version, but 5.5/Sp2 will do the trick.
